Risk Reward for Bank PKO BP (PKO.WA) has been updated
Reason for change
Following resilient Q2, we raise our core revenue forecasts by ~1% and modestly
lower our 2026 cost assumptions. Together, these changes lift our bottom-line
estimates by 2-3%. With the macro outlook remaining supportive and operating
momentum solid, we also lower our cost of equity assumption to 11.0% from 11.5%.
As the bank went ex dividend on 4th August, we deduct 2025 dividend from our
valuation. As a result, we raise our price target to PLN 125 from PLN 120 and
reiterate our Overweight rating.
